The cryptocurrency market is showing signs of selective momentum as Bitcoin Cash (BCH) surges amid strong technical indicators, while Cardano (ADA) faces downward pressure with growing bearish sentiment. Despite a relatively quiet macroeconomic backdrop, key digital assets are diverging in performance—highlighting the importance of on-chain and technical dynamics in shaping short-term price action.
Total crypto market capitalization has edged up to $3.283 trillion, reflecting a modest 0.81% daily gain. Meanwhile, traditional markets remain stable, with the S&P 500 inching up 0.07% to 6,097 points. The Federal Reserve’s decision to hold interest rates steady at 4.25%–4.5% continues to foster a cautious "wait-and-see" environment among investors. Fed Chair Jerome Powell emphasized that the central bank is “well positioned to wait” for clearer economic signals before making further moves.
With geopolitical tensions easing following a ceasefire between Israel and Iran, earlier market spikes have settled. Today, only two cryptocurrencies—Pi and Maple Finance—surpass a 10% gain, while the average movement across the top 100 coins by market cap hovers around ±2%.

Bitcoin Cash (BCH): Technical Strength Signals Breakout Potential
Bitcoin Cash, one of the earliest Bitcoin forks, is demonstrating renewed strength with a 6% rally to $481.30**, breaking above the critical **$470 resistance level—a barrier that had constrained price action for much of the month. This breakout was accompanied by increased trading volume and multiple confirming technical signals, suggesting genuine buying interest.
Key Technical Indicators
- Relative Strength Index (RSI): Sitting at 61, the RSI reflects strong bullish momentum without entering overbought territory (typically above 70). This indicates sustained buying pressure with room for further upside.
- Average Directional Index (ADX): At 20, ADX remains just below the 25 threshold that signifies a strong trend. However, its upward trajectory suggests momentum is building toward a more defined bullish move.
- Moving Averages: BCH is trading well above both its 50-day EMA (~$385)** and **200-day EMA (~$352). The widening gap between these averages signals a healthy uptrend and growing investor confidence. When shorter-term moving averages rise faster than longer-term ones, it often reflects strong accumulation.
- Squeeze Momentum Indicator: Currently in "ON" mode with upward momentum, this suggests a period of low volatility has ended and price expansion is underway—typically preceding significant directional moves.
Strategic Price Levels
- Immediate Support: $460–$470 (former resistance, now support)
- Strong Support: $385 (50-day EMA)
- Immediate Resistance: $500 (psychological barrier and next technical hurdle)
- Strong Resistance: $540 (projected target based on prior consolidation pattern)
The combination of volume-backed breakout, favorable momentum, and positive moving average divergence positions BCH as one of the day’s standout performers. While not yet in overbought territory, traders should watch for signs of exhaustion near $500.

Cardano (ADA): Bearish Pressure Mounts Amid Leadership Moves
In contrast, Cardano is under pressure, shedding 3.5% to $0.5669**, as bearish technical patterns converge with uncertainty around ecosystem strategy. The drop follows comments from founder Charles Hoskinson during a recent livestream, where he proposed reallocating nearly **$100 million worth of ADA from the project’s treasury into stablecoins, Bitcoin, and synthetic assets.
While framed as a move to enhance DeFi liquidity and decentralize treasury risk, some market participants interpreted this as a lack of confidence in ADA’s near-term prospects—especially given that the asset hasn’t seen a sustained bullish cycle since 2021.
Technical Outlook: Red Flags Across the Board
- RSI at 35: Approaching oversold levels (<30), but downward momentum remains strong. Readings below 40 often signal persistent bearish control.
- ADX at 26: Confirms a strong trend is in place—but since price is falling, this reflects powerful selling pressure rather than bullish conviction.
- Moving Averages: ADA trades below both its 50-day and 200-day EMAs, forming a classic "death cross" pattern when the shorter average falls below the longer one. This structure often precedes extended downtrends.
- Squeeze Momentum Indicator: Shows "OFF" status with negative momentum, indicating downside volatility has already released and further sharp declines may be limited—at least temporarily.
Key Support and Resistance Zones
- Immediate Support: $0.5500 (psychological level and potential bounce zone)
- Strong Support: $0.5000 (major round number and long-term floor)
- Immediate Resistance: $0.5900 (must reclaim for any recovery signal)
- Strong Resistance: $0.6400 (region of 50-day EMA—reclaiming this would suggest trend reversal)
Without clear catalysts or positive sentiment shifts, ADA risks testing stronger support levels in the coming days.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
What does a breakout mean in crypto trading?
A breakout occurs when an asset's price moves beyond a defined support or resistance level with increased volume. In Bitcoin Cash’s case, breaking above $470 signals potential continuation of an uptrend, especially when confirmed by momentum indicators like RSI and moving averages.
Why is Cardano falling despite positive ecosystem news?
Sometimes strategic decisions—like treasury diversification—can be misinterpreted as lack of faith in the native token. Combined with weak technicals (e.g., price below key EMAs and declining RSI), such moves can trigger sell-offs even if intended for long-term stability.
How reliable are RSI and ADX in predicting price moves?
RSI helps identify overbought or oversold conditions, while ADX measures trend strength—not direction. Together, they offer valuable context: high ADX with rising RSI suggests strong bullish momentum; high ADX with falling RSI confirms bearish dominance.
What is moving average divergence?
It refers to the expanding gap between short-term and long-term moving averages (like 50-day and 200-day EMAs). When prices rise above both and the shorter MA accelerates upward, it signals strong bullish momentum and sustained buying pressure.
